Think Global, Act Local: Staying Relevant in the Age of AI & Automation
Today’s business intelligence (BI) and data leaders are experiencing a seismic shift in their roles. As data leaders are no longer behind the scenes at the back of the enterprise looking at data infrastructure or reporting, they are now at the forefront of implementing enterprise-wide data strategy and innovation strategy with AI-led value, essentially tying technical teams to real business outcomes. Globally the impetus on data focused leadership has never been greater, 98% of organisations are increasing their investments in data and AI, but there is also immense pressure to be able to drive value. 84% of enterprises have appointed a Chief Data or Analytics Officer responsible to create and implement this agenda, yet less than half consider their CDOs to have been “very successful” to this point. This represents one of the challenges that data leaders face: as data leaders begin to rise strategically, they must prove their worth with speed, otherwise their positions will be short-lived, with over 53% of CDOs around the world serving less than 3 years. Tomorrow’s BI & Data leader will be the intersection of technical understanding, business intelligence, and leverage of a leadership influence for them to survive and thrive in this rapidly changing landscape.
At the same time, whether you live in Europe, the USA, Africa, or Asia, disruptive technologies like artificial intelligence, automation and generative AI are restructuring the competitive landscape. Almost every business in the world is embracing these technologies; over 77% are using AI or using AI in some capacity – Africa is certainly following suit. African organisations are catching up fast: globally over 40% of AI organisations have started to deploy AI solutions (including advanced analytics and even generative AI); and over 85% should be investing in AI by 2029. While African firms are behind the best of the global leaders in frontier applications (generative AI) (27% of African companies are using generative AI vs ~32% globally), this gap is closing very fast.
Ultimately, the next-gen BI & Data leader must evolve into a strategic business partner who can navigate fast-moving technology trends while keeping the organisations vision in focus. This talk will blend global trends with an African context, highlighting how Africa data leaders are innovating despite resource constraints and how they can leverage global best practices to leapfrog ahead.
